Guest jonesjeremya Posted October 26, 2010 Report Posted October 26, 2010 (edited) I am stuck! Please help! I have searched this forum and others, and tried tried the suggestions from others who have had the same issue, the suggestions worked for them...but not for me... I Successfully updated to O2, 1.6, build 4399 by using the following guide and linked package files, http://android.modaco.com/content/dell-str...ing-the-streak/ I started the guide verbatim, based on the information in the guide. I started at the title heading "Upgrading from AT&T 1.6 (build 6601) to O2 2.1 (build 8105)" Afterwords, it was successfully loaded .....O2, 1.6, 4399..... I get to the next part of the guide titled "Now your AT&T Streak is on the same build and version of Android as the original UK O2 Streak. If you've made it this far upgrading to 2.1 is a piece of cake." I followed the directions provided in the guide, to go from O2 1.6 4399 to O2 2.1 8105, verbatim as well as using the links provided for the files. But I get stuck at the Dell logo when the reboot takes place after the upgrade to O2, 2.1, 8105. There are no glitches or other occurrences which would indicate any errors or anomalies. So this is the point where I am stuck. :P When trying to go to O2, 2.1 (various builds attempted 8105, 6941, and the official O2 2.1 from Dell) the streak is stuck at the dell logo on re-boot, all three buttons lights on, and will stay that way until the battery dies. I have tried the following 2.1 upgrades with no success. I ALWAYS get stuck at the dell logo when ever the upgrade process has completed and the Streak re-boots. I am able to pull the SD card, copy the O2 1.6, 4399 build update.pkg back on the SD card and essentially "downgrade" or re-follow the original instruction steps as if I was upgrading. The unit will then be functional as O2 1.6, 4399. Am I missing something critical. I have scoured for information, but just can't get past the point where 2.1 won't boot. I am wondering if there is a difference in the streaks form dell direct, and the streaks from Best Buy. I hope someone here can point me in the right direction. I have an At&t Dell Streak, bought it two days ago from Best Buy. I'm really going to love it if I can get 2.2 on it! Thanks for any help, and thanks for a great site. Guest jackgt Posted October 26, 2010 Report Posted October 26, 2010 When I had this problem it was because I forgot to rename the pkg file. It has to be named "upgrade.pkg". I ended up having to put the SD card into a card reader in my laptop, rename it, then bingo I was good to go.

Jeremy Hmm, I have an idea of what went wrong, the recovery image bootloader must have been overwritten when you started the streak, so when you got to step10, it didn't work. Here is the solution. Perform my instructions in this order: 5, 6, 7, 1, 2, 3 ,4 , 8, 9, 10. If you get through step10 successfully, you can continue following the instructions. Let me know how that goes. Specifically that when you get to step 4, you see "Download RECOVERY Done" and in Step 10, you get that second screen to select "update.zip".
